Career path

Career Roles Key Responsibilities
Online Safety Educator Educate children and parents on online safety best practices
Online Safety Consultant Provide guidance and recommendations to organizations on online safety measures
Online Safety Trainer Conduct training sessions on online safety for children and adults
Online Safety Analyst Analyze online safety trends and develop strategies to address emerging risks
Online Safety Advocate Promote awareness of online safety issues and advocate for policy changes
